Buying Guide

What matters most when choosing an automatic pool suction cleaner?

  • Pool type and size: Choose a model compatible with your pool (in-ground vs above-ground) and its length or shape.
  • Power and flow requirements: Confirm pump horsepower or minimum flow to ensure optimal cleaning and wall-climbing ability.
  • Suction-only vs motorized power: This guide focuses on suction-side cleaners; consider motorized options if you need more aggressive cleaning or separate pumps.
  • Hose length and wear: Longer hoses cover larger surfaces but may add drag; look for scuff-resistant hoses to protect finishes.
  • Noise level and setup: Quiet operation is beneficial for poolside use, especially in backyards or shared spaces.
  • Maintenance and parts: Replaceable wheels, diaphragms, and valves influence long-term costs and downtime.

Practical questions to help you choose

  • What pool flow does my system require for best suction? Check pump horsepower and flow rate and match to the cleaner’s minimum requirements.
  • Will this cleaner handle walls and steps? Look for wall-climbing capability and wheel deflectors designed for corners.
  • Can I reuse my existing filtration? Suction-side cleaners typically connect to the skimmer or dedicated suction line without a separate pump.
  • Is hose length adjustable for my pool size? Ensure you have enough hose to reach all areas without tangling.
  • How easy is maintenance and part replacement? Consider models with accessible parts like wheels, diaphragms, and hoses.
  • What are the trade-offs between noise and cleaning speed? Quieter models often trade some speed for peaceful operation, which may matter for daytime use.

FAQ

  1. Do suction pool cleaners require a dedicated pump? No, they typically connect to your existing pool pump via the skimmer or suction line.
  2. Can I use a suction cleaner with an above-ground pool? Yes, many models are designed for both above-ground and in-ground pools, but check the product specs.
  3. How do I optimize cleaning performance? Ensure correct hose length, verify adequate pump flow, and adjust weights or regulator valves as directed by the manufacturer.
  4. Will these cleaners damage my pool finish? Most modern hoses are scuff-resistant; ensure proper seating and avoid sharp edges or damaged rails.
  5. Are there maintenance tips for longevity? Regularly inspect diaphragms, wheels, and hoses; clean debris from suction ports and ensure no clogs.
  6. What should I consider if cleaning efficiency drops? Reassess pump flow, tighten connections, and verify that the cleaner is not jammed by debris in the intake.
